Replace misted glass unit

If you've had misty double glazing in your home, you may be thinking about how to fix it. There are a variety of solutions that can help you save money and boost your property's value while doing so.

The first step is to determine the kind of condensation you've got. This can be done by visiting your local window store or by searching the internet for reliable information.

A glass piece is made up of two panes, each of which is separated by a spacer bar. If you notice gaps between the two, this is a sign of a failure. This can be repaired by drilling holes and injecting a liquid sealant. However the seals won't last for long.

If your home is plagued by misty windows, you should consider replacing them with a brand new well-sealed unit. This will prevent heat escaping and reduce your energy bills.

If you are considering an upgrade, you may consider changing to energy efficient glass. To increase the efficiency of your home you could choose double-glazed units that are A-rated.

Many companies provide replacement units. Many offer discounts on multiple units. Based on the size of your window, you could end up saving the whole lot. It is also possible to make a DIY kit to repair the damaged glass unit. These kits are just temporary fixes and won't fix the root of the issue.

Professional glass companies provide the glass with a guarantee to help you get the most of your investment. They can provide the most efficient solution for your unique situation.

Another option is to put in a gasket seal. This is less labor-intensive and will ensure your window remains airtight. A new gasket can boost the energy efficiency of your home.

Misty windows are a common problem in the UK. A small hole is cut for access to the glass panes. This is then filled using an appropriate drying agent. You could also make use of silica crystals for absorbing the moisture.

Replace the friction stays

When it is time for uPVC window repairs, you may be thinking about replacing of the friction stay. This device assists in maintaining the sash's balance and allows it to shut and open correctly.

There are many sizes and depths that are available for these devices. It is essential to make sure that the device you select is the correct length and thickness. Also, ensure that the holes are drilled in the frame.

It's important to remember that a sash can be heavy so you should have two people working together to ensure you get the job done right. The first person should drop it to the right distance, and the second person should assist it as they perform the actual work.

To complete the task you'll need to remove the hinges. If you don't feel capable of the task, you can get someone to do it for you. For the most part the standard size hinges are the best option.

There are many kinds of friction stays. Some are designed to provide child safety, while others are designed to give more space for the sash to adjust. They are available for top-hung and side-hung windows.

In addition to taking out the old ones, you should also clear the sash of any debris. This will ensure that it works efficiently and avoids any future issues. Additionally, lubricating the moving parts of your sash will help to keep them from wearing out.

Replace window lock jammer sash

Sash jammer window locks can be employed to secure your windows. A sash-jammer is attached to the sash and locks the window when shut. They are also very easy to install, and can be utilized on numerous types of doors as well as windows.

There are a variety of locks that can be used to secure windows in sash. Chain locks are one type. The lock is confined to the opening distance and is a good option for windows with large openings. The bolt-action lock is a different option. These locks let you lock your sash into different places and require brackets to secure the upper sash.

Depending on the type of window you might need two or more locks. If you are unsure you should consult a professional or look online for help.

The Fab and Fix Sash Jammer is a simple method to improve the security of your windows. It is key lockable, and can be fitted to reinforced or non-reinforced sections.

A Sash jammer is an excellent method to increase the security of your home. It can be used for all types of windows. They are simple to install and cost-effective. There are a variety of styles and colors to suit your personal preferences.
